I mentioned this in some other thread about video games, but I found that in Mafia III, the more memory that was being occupied by other poo poo (streaming Netflix and Hulu with an absurd number of open tabs on another monitor in my case when I learned this trick) the longer it would take to spawn enemies. However, mission-specific objects would spawn immediately. So if the mission was to fight my way through 100 rednecks just to steal a briefcase, I frequently could get in and out before anyone appeared.

However, this trick was really unreliable. More often than not, it would just spawn all the enemies right when I was in the middle of them and they would just tear me to poo poo with a single unified shotgun blast from all angles.

Prerendered cutscenes I find annoying now, since we've reached a point where our systems can render the cutscene in real time and have it look just as good, if not better. Max Payne 3 and some of the Yakuza games have cutscenes that use all in-game models and textures but are prerendered, and you can tell because the frame rate is cut in half and everyone looks a little blurry. Max Payne 3 was especially awkward for me because actually the videos were rendered at what seemed like the same resolution I was playing, and I didn't realize these were prerendered; I just kept wondering why every third cutscene everything drops to 30 fps.
